4.5X More Grade A Mall Space Leased Than Delivered in H1 2026

Retailers leased 4.1 Mn sq ft of Grade A mall space in H1 2026, 4.5X new supply, as vacancy fell to 6.7%, says ANAROCK.

GCCs Capture 45% of India’s Office Leasing in H1 2026

GCCs accounted for 45% of India’s 42.6 Mn sq ft office leasing in H1 2026; vacancy drops to 15% and average rents climb 9% to Rs 96 per sq ft.
